#3ad666 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3ad666 is composed of 22.7% red, 83.9%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.3%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 136.9 degrees, a saturation of 65.5% and a lightness of 53.3%. #3ad666 color hex could be obtained by blending #74ffcc with #00ad00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#3ad666

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030e06 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3ad666

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838d86 is the less saturated color, while #15fb56 is the most saturated one.
